Rumble Resources Limited ( ASX: RTR ) (“ Rumble ” or the “ Company ”) provides this update on the upcoming exploration program and potential development of the Western Queen Gold Project.

Exploration – diamond drill program on track to commence this week

Gold exploration – infill and extension diamond drilling

The Company is planning a diamond drill program of up to 20,000m at Western Queen which is on track to commence this week. The drilling contact has been awarded to well-known Western Australia drilling contractor DDH1 Drilling (DDH1) and the first rig is being mobilised to site this week. DDH1 will supply two diamond rigs, and it is anticipated that the program will be completed by February 2026.

The key focus of this diamond drill program is to target high-grade down plunge extensions at Western Queen South (refer to Figure 1) and Western Queen Central deposits (refer to Figure 2) to grow the recently updated Western Queen gold Mineral Resource Estimate (MRE) of 3.72Mt @ 3.1g/t Au for a total of 370,000 oz Au. A small portion of the proposed drilling program will infill the existing Western Queen South MRE which currently stands at 2.32Mt @ 2.66g/t Au for 198,900 oz[3] , with the aim of converting a portion of the existing Inferred Resources to Indicated Resources in support of the ongoing underground mining scoping study. It is anticipated that the proposed drilling will provide the basis for a future update of the Western Queen MRE in early 2026.

==> picture [456 x 393] intentionally omitted <==

Figure 2 – Western Queen Central and Princess longitudinal section showing gram x metre contours, select drill hole intersections and proposed extensional drilling (red circles, below the current MRE) and proposed infill resource conversion drilling (blue circles)

The proposed diamond drilling program will also be used to target tungsten skarn lodes, which are spatially adjacent, and sub-parallel to, the high-grade gold lodes. The Company recently announced a maiden Western Queen tungsten MRE of 4.31Mt @ 0.31% WO3 for 13.2Kt WO3 at a 0.1% WO3 cut-off which contains a highergrade portion of 1.44Mt @ 0.51% WO3 for 7.4Kt WO3 at 0.3% WO3 cut off (see Figure 3 and Table 1).

Geological investigations and petrographic studies have confirmed tungsten mineralisation at Western Queen represents an early prograde endoskarn mineralisation event which predates orogenic gold mineralisation. Petrographic studies have also confirmed that the observed tungsten mineralisation observed to date represents a very distal skarn mineralisation environment. The upcoming drill program will assist in developing the understanding of tungsten mineralisation at Western Queen, as well as underpin a potential future tungsten MRE update.

Mining Studies – open pit and/or underground options

Western Queen Open Pit Option

MEGA Resources Pty Ltd (MEGA) has updated the mining schedule for the Western Queen South open pit taking into consideration the 23 July 2025 MRE upgrade. The revised schedule shows the production over a two-year period from a combination of Western Queen South, Princess and Cranes.

The revised schedule results in a working capital investment by Bain Global Resources (Bain) in excess of the $35 million ($25 million working capital facility and up to $10 million cost overrun facility) referred to in the 28 November 2024 Term Sheet (the Term Sheet)[4] .

MEGA have since prepared a smaller Western Queen South open pit option which is being reviewed by the Company. This option could allow for open pit mining ahead of, or in conjunction with underground mining.

Western Queen South and Central Underground Option

In parallel with the open pit project Rumble initiated a “proof of concept” underground mining study. The outcome of the preliminary underground study demonstrated very favourable economics. As a result, a detailed scoping study on mining both Western Queen South and Central from underground is now being undertaken and should be delivered early in the December 2025 quarter.

Expiry of Term Sheet with Bain and MEGA

Given the need to complete to the original open pit mine optimisation, complete the underground scoping study and secure an ore purchase or toll milling arrangement with one of the gold processing plants in the vicinity of Western Queen, the decision was made to defer the signing of the Definitive Agreements contemplated by the 28 November 2024 Term Sheet (the Term Sheet) pending the outcome of these various work streams. Consequently, the parties mutually agreed to extend the execution date of the Definitive Agreements as detailed in the Term Sheet to 30 September 2025 Notwithstanding that the Term Sheet has expired, the Company intends to complete the underground scoping study and review of the underground option compared to the open pit options which have been presented.

Third party processing

Discussions have continued with the owners of gold processing plants in the vicinity of Western Queen. A draft ore tolling agreement has been received from one of these groups and is being reviewed by the Company.

Potential Tungsten Revenue Stream

The maiden Western Queen tungsten Mineral Resource Estimate of 4.3Mt at 0.31% WO3 for 13.2kt WO3 was released on 23 August 2025 and is summarised in Table 1.

==> picture [455 x 174] intentionally omitted <==

Preliminary metallurgical testwork results indicate tungsten recoveries that could yield an economic return to the Company. This needs to be verified by detailed metallurgical testwork and further study work. A bulk sample of the tungsten bearing (scheelite) material has been prepared for detailed metallurgical testing. This metallurgical testwork program will commence during the December 2025 quarter.

About Rumble

Rumble Resources Ltd is an Australian based exploration company, listed on the ASX in July 2011. Rumble was established with the aim of adding significant value to its selected mineral exploration assets and to search for suitable mineral acquisition opportunities in Western Australia.

Rumble has a unique suite of resources projects including the Western Queen Gold Project which is being developed to deliver near term cash flow from the existing resources and resource growth through future exploration success. In addition, the discovery of the Earaheedy Zn-Pb-Ag Project has demonstrated the capabilities of the exploration team to find world class orebodies.
